THE PROBLEM
Entering the UK market unprepared
The UK digital health market is one of the most regulated and structurally complex in the world. The NHS operates its own procurement frameworks, clinical safety standards, and technology assessment criteria that have no direct equivalent in the US, EU, or GCC markets. What works elsewhere does not automatically transfer.
International companies routinely underestimate the compliance burden, misjudge the procurement timeline, and approach NHS commissioners without the evidence pack those commissioners require. The result is delayed market entry, wasted business development spend, and reputational damage with the very buyers they were trying to impress.
Entering the UK digital health market without specialist advisory is not bold. It is expensive.

What is DCB0129 and do I need it?
DCB0129 is the NHS clinical risk management standard for health IT systems. If your product is used in a clinical setting, interfaces with patient data, or is being procured by an NHS organisation, you almost certainly need it. It requires a documented clinical safety case, a hazard log, and sign-off by a qualified Clinical Safety Officer. We handle all of this.
